This paper presents a client-server software that violates security rules defined by firewalls and proxies. A firewall is
a set of components, interposed between two networks, that filters the traffic according to rules based on a security policy.
Several techniques may be used to make firewalls obsolete, for instance: tunneling and cryptography. The software presented
in this paper is composed by two modules: a client and a server one. the client module must be installed in any host of the
local network that is not protected by a firewall or a proxy. The server module must be installed in the Internet, in a host
accessible by the client module. With this software, it’s possible to bypass firewalls and proxies.
